In the Old Town, dozens of old narrow streets and alleys remain. These closes and wynds were once bustling places of working and living. Some have been preserved over the course of 400 years, and are part of the city's cultural heritage. Some have been redeveloped and include newer bars, restaurants and shops.

There are a few points that every driver who is new know before taking the road test. You must know the Highway Code, and you should be aware of the meanings behind road signs. It's also important to read the driving manual and watch a video on how to operate a vehicle.
You can also enroll in the Pass Plus course. This will give you extra training and will make you a safer driver. It is not a requirement but it can help you save money on your insurance costs. Most driving schools charge an extra fee for this service.
